Startup Legal Essentials: A Roadmap for Success

Embarking on a startup journey offers a unique opportunity to bring your vision to life. However, amidst the excitement and innovation, it's crucial to establish a solid legal foundation from the outset. Neglecting legal considerations can lead to unforeseen complications down the road, compromising your startup's growth and success. This roadmap outlines essential legal essentials that every budding entrepreneur should consider.

  • Forming the Right Legal Structure: Selecting a suitable legal structure, such as a sole proprietorship, partnership, LLC, or corporation, holds considerable implications for your liability, taxation, and overall operations.
  • Safeguarding Intellectual Property: Your ideas and creations are invaluable assets. Obtain patents, trademarks, and copyrights to safeguard your intellectual property rights and avoid infringement.
  • Drafting Essential Contracts: From agreements with employees and investors to vendor contracts and customer terms of service, clear and comprehensive contracts are essential for defining rights, responsibilities, and expectations.
  • Adhering Regulatory Requirements: Subject to your industry and location, your startup may be subject to specific regulations and licenses. Guarantee compliance to avoid penalties and legal issues.

Bear in mind that this roadmap provides a general overview. It's strongly recommended to consult with an experienced attorney to navigate your specific legal needs and circumstances. By proactively integrating these legal essentials, you can set your startup on the path to sustainable growth and success.
